Senegalese Student Visa & Residence Card
For foreign students enrolled at a Senegalese institution, allowing them to enter and reside for the duration of their studies.

- Official name
- Visa étudiant / carte d'identité d'étranger (étudiant)
- Route type
- Study visa plus residence registration
- Basis
- Enrolment at a recognised Senegalese institution
- Register after arrival
- Within the first 3 months of stay
Who it is for
- Foreign nationals admitted to study at a recognised Senegalese university or institution
Requirements
- Proof of enrolment / admission at a recognised institution
- Valid passport with at least 6 months validity
- Proof of sufficient funds and of accommodation
- Medical certificate
- Registration with the DPETV for the foreigner identity card after arrival
How to apply
- Apply for the long-stay student visa at a Senegalese embassy or consulate (if not visa-exempt)
- After arrival, register with the DPETV to obtain the foreigner identity card / residence card
- Renew in line with continued enrolment
